Switches are really simple components. When you press a button or flip a lever, they connect two contacts together so that electricity can flow through them.

The little tactile switches that are used in this lesson have four connections, which can be a little confusing.

Actually, there are only really two electrical connections, as inside the switch package pins B and C are connected together, as are A and D.
